how can we differentiate moraxella and haemophilis
@physeo-USMLE
@physeo-USMLE 4 жыл бұрын
Hey! Moraxella are gram negative cocci and Haemophilus are gram negative bacilli or coccobacilli. There are also a bunch of other tests that can be used to specifically identify Haemophilus, such as the fact that it requires factors V and X for growth.
